It's 1998 in Carroll Gardens, Brooklyn, where the close-knit Italian-American community clings to its traditions. The week of Halloween, a shocking discovery shatters the festivities. The body of Mary Pat, a prickly and unpopular neighbor, is found on her balcony, meticulously posed and disguised as a holiday witch.
Helper, a beloved local handyman, known for his gentle nature and neurodivergent quirks, becomes one of the suspects in the ensuing investigation. When Helper's nephew, a new detective, works to unravel the mystery, long-held secrets and buried traumas are revealed.
Told from three perspectives, this captivating story explores the complexities of justice and family loyalty, while the depiction of Carroll Gardens is rendered with affection and humor.
